Audit Office Chief Criticizes Prime Minister for Meeting with Businessman Instead of State Institutions

Share:

The head of Slovakia's Supreme Audit Office expressed surprise that Prime Minister Robert Fico chose to meet with businessman Jaroslav Haščák rather than consulting with the country's competition authority or audit office. The criticism came from Ľubomír Andrassy, who leads the Supreme Audit Office, Slovakia's independent institution responsible for overseeing government spending and financial management. Andrassy suggested that patients' interests are being placed last in priority, though the specific context of this healthcare-related comment was not detailed. The remarks highlight tensions over the government's consultation practices, particularly regarding which voices are prioritized in policy discussions involving major business figures versus state oversight bodies.
